1. Cala Coticcio
Begin your journey with a visit to Cala Coticcio, dubbed "Little Tahiti" for its turquoise waters and pristine sand. Experience the thrill of discovering this secluded beach that's perfect for families seeking a peaceful day by the sea.
2. Isola di Caprera
Dive into local history and natural beauty by exploring Caprera Island. With hiking trails, stunning landscapes, and the chance to encounter local wildlife, it’s a must-visit for families looking for unique experiences away from the usual tourist traps.
3. Spiaggia di Bassa Trinita
For a beach day with shallow waters ideal for children, head to Spiaggia di Bassa Trinita. Enjoy the soft sands and safe swimming conditions while soaking up the Sardinian sun.
4. La Maddalena Archipelago National Park
Embrace the opportunity to explore the breathtaking natural park encompassing several islands and islets. A boat tour provides an exciting way for families to enjoy varied landscapes and wildlife encounters.
5. Church of Santa Maria Maddalena
Step back in time with a visit to this charming 18th-century church. The Church of Santa Maria Maddalena offers a peaceful retreat and insight into the area's rich cultural heritage.
6. Garibaldi's Compendium
This museum is a tribute to the Italian unification hero Giuseppe Garibaldi. It offers educational opportunities for families interested in history and provides a lovely backdrop for a day of learning and fun.
7. Cala Spalmatore
Seek out Cala Spalmatore for a quiet beach escape. Families looking for a place to snorkel or simply unwind will find this hidden gem appealing.
8. Via Garibaldi
Wander through this bustling street to experience local life, shop for souvenirs, and taste traditional Sardinian cuisine. It's a convenient spot for family dining and cultural immersion.
9. Punta Tegge
Visit Punta Tegge for an afternoon of scenic views and tranquil walks along the rocky coastline. It’s a safe spot for families to explore and enjoy a picnic with a view.
10. Nido d’Aquila
Perfect for families seeking a bit of adventure, the Nido d'Aquila offers trails and vistas that reward with panoramic views. Experience hiking suitable for various skill levels.
